In 2024, Minnesota Mutual Companies, Inc. reported total carbon emissions of approximately 8,797,000 kg CO2e. This figure includes 983,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1 emissions and 7,814,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2 emissions, based on location. The previous year, 2023, saw total emissions of about 10,396,000 kg CO2e, with Scope 1 emissions at 1,130,000 kg CO2e and Scope 2 emissions at 9,266,000 kg CO2e (location-based). In 2022, emissions were higher at approximately 11,643,000 kg CO2e, with Scope 1 at 1,126,000 kg CO2e and Scope 2 at 10,517,000 kg CO2e. Despite these figures, Minnesota Mutual Companies, Inc. has not set specific reduction targets or initiatives, nor do they participate in recognised climate pledges such as the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i). The company has not disclosed any Scope 3 emissions data, which typically includes indirect emissions from the value chain. Overall, while Minnesota Mutual Companies, Inc. has made strides in tracking and reporting emissions, their lack of defined reduction targets indicates an area for potential improvement in their climate commitments.
